Problem
The owner-builder of a 5500 sq. ft. custom single-family home in Fair Oaks (Sacramento) sued our client, CA Construction, for construction defect, breach of contract, negligence and violations of Business and Professions codes related to contractor licensure issues. Plaintiff asked the jury to return a verdict in their favor and award damages of $750,000.00.
Solution
Todd Jones and Greg Federico took the case to trial. After two and a half weeks, a Sacramento jury returned a defense verdict in favor of our client on all three causes of action.
Result
As the prevailing party, our client will seek attorneys’ fees and costs allowed per contract, plus additional costs based on an expired $25,000 CCP §998 Offer to Compromise.
